Year: 1999
Runtime: 104 mins
Language: English
Director: Nickolas Perry
In the unforgiving streets of Las Vegas, a naïve drifter abandons his army‑father's expectations to chase a career in car racing. He encounters a clever young scam artist who falls for him, and through her is pulled into a gang led by an ambitious hustler. As he strives to become a racer, he is thrust into a series of wild, high‑stakes situations that test his dreams and loyalty.

In the neon‑washed streets of Las Vegas, a restless young man chases a dream that feels as distant as the desert horizon. Johnny has escaped the expectations of an army‑father, trading a structured life for the gritty promise of a stock‑car career. The desert city, with its endless billboards and echoing roulette wheels, becomes both a sanctuary and a crucible for anyone daring enough to gamble on ambition. Against this backdrop, the hum of engines and the clang of casino chips form a soundtrack for a road that could lead either to glory or to exile.
Amid the shimmering chaos, Eric appears—a quick‑witted scam artist who knows every shortcut through the city’s underbelly. Their connection is immediate, a blend of mutual curiosity and unspoken longing that pulls Johnny deeper into a world where loyalty is bought and sold in whispered deals. Around them moves Steve, a charismatic hustler whose confidence masks a complicated past, and Veronica, a seasoned survivor who offers guidance to those who wander too far off the neon‑lit path. Together they form a loose, volatile crew whose aspirations are as tangled as the streets they navigate.
